The architectural styles,forms,and masonry methods of traditional rural dwellings in Heilongjiang Province are very different from modern buildings.Among them,the native dwellings have a unique construction style and still occupy a large proportion in Heilongjiang rural areas.However,among these village houses with local features,most of the houses do not meet the needs of modern residents’ life well,and they appear pale and weak in the coordination of modern residential life.In the context of rural society being greatly impacted by urbanization,buildings representing traditional rural construction culture are facing huge challenges.Just like biodiversity,we must protect the cultural diversity of the region as we protect biodiversity.This article uses literature research,field surveys and other methods to make detailed records of the architectural forms and living conditions of the native houses,and obtain first-hand data as the research basis.It also sorts out the evolution profile,distribution characteristics and construction methods of raw soil dwellings.Through the quantitative analysis of the survey questionnaire and the on-site measurement of the native residential houses,the main livability problems faced by the residents are summarized.Establish three factors that are strongly related to the main livability issues of native-soil dwellings in Heilongjiang,namely the strength of the wall structure,the indoor temperature environment,and the image of construction style.On this basis,with the help of relevant livable concepts and standards,it analyzes the construction skills,architectural style,material characteristics,and living feelings of the native houses.Through the analysis of the raw soil wall structure in Heilongjiang Province,the temperature environment measurement in summer and winter,and the in-depth study of the characteristics of residential construction,we try to resolve the contradiction between continuation of traditional cultural genes and optimizing the living environment.Learn from the experience of traditional construction techniques,and propose optimal design strategies and measures suitable for the native dwellings in Heilongjiang to achieve the effect of improving a certain degree of livability.The intention is to provide a certain reference basis for the construction and design of native soil dwellings in this area.The main innovation of this paper is to use quantitative analysis methods to optimize the ratio of the local raw soil construction materials in Heilongjiang area to find the ratio of raw soil wall materials with higher compressive strength.It provides a certain basis for the construction of rural dwellings in Heilongjiang,and supplements the research content of dwellings in this area.Improve the performance of raw soil,optimize the detailed structure,and increase wall reinforcement measures through experiments.Increasing indoor temperature and heat preservation practices to improve the living quality of native houses.And to explore the cultural connotation of the native houses in Heilongjiang area,design native houses with different styles and features,beautify the style and image of the houses,and enhance the residents’ sense of identity and belonging.Provide certain ideas for the diversified development of rural residential styles,so that the native residential buildings will rejuvenate and develop in the direction of healthy,livable and beautiful image. |
